We are in an age where we want to access the world online as much as possible. Undoubtedly, this ever-increasing trend towards digitization indicates the continuous online availability of web applications. Not to mention, this is daunting work and requires a robust platform for hosting. And the best solution to this is cloud computing in web development. There are several benefits of cloud computing in web development. The use of cloud computing in web development gives leverage to cloud-based services at a lower cost. This helps in avoiding setting up an individual server separately and maintaining them.
Moreover, if the business requires geographical expansion, maintaining the servers in multiple locations is an additional operating cost for the company. Moreover, coupled with the power of internet technology, cloud computing will be addressing this requirement very well.
However, the reason mentioned above is not the only limit to cloud computing serviceability in web development. Moreover, the list is increasing over the period with the developing solutions in cloud computing. In further sections, we will be discussing the benefits of cloud computing in web development.
What is Cloud Computing in Web Development?
Before discussing the benefits of cloud computing in web development, let’s take an overview of a cloud-based web app.
To start with, traditional web apps it is exclusively browser dependent. But, this is not the case for a cloud-based web app. Interconnected devices are able to access it through custom-built apps in the cloud. In addition, cloud-based web apps possess a few more characteristics, which include:
– Data caching can be performed in full-offline mode.
– Additional support for data backup with data compression, security, and scheduling.
– Cloud infrastructure stores the data
– The app can be utilized to access cloud provided additional services such as on-demand computing cycle, storage, application development platforms, etc.
Benefits of Cloud Computing in Web Development
The benefits of cloud computing in web development can be analyzed from two perspectives:
Benefits of Cloud-Based Web Development
Let’s begin from a business point of view. Why are cloud hosting services becoming the enterprise’s choice? Therefore, the verdict is inclining toward cloud computing infrastructure benefits, which include many. The following are some of them:
The online presence is an important matter since a lot is based on its easy accessibility and availability across the locations. To meet these two crucial conditions, the business requires to focus on three areas:
– The speed of the application
– Geographical accessibility
– Minimum downtime
However, can it be possible with on-premises server solutions? Yes, it can be done with multiple high-end server configurations. Hence, leading to a huge investment. Interestingly, cloud computing is bringing a scalable platform that offers less downtime, speed, and geographical reach without user experience limitations and numbers.
Security is one of the major factors when an application is hosted on the internet. Because it is handling customer personal data, financial data, and confidential data related to an organization, and it could be anything. Therefore, if not correctly handled, it can impact a business poorly.
To present, the cloud security model is a shared security model where both the consumer of the services and the cloud vendor are accountable for securing the applications in the cloud. Generally, cloud security architecture differs based on the cloud model (PaaS, IaaS, and SaaS). However, there are a few primary security features, which include :
– Single Sign-On feature for several accounts for various service providers. This is making IT administration easier from the monitoring point of view.
– It is helping in the prevention of data loss with appropriate tools.
– It is aiding in the prevention of data loss with appropriate tools.
Web applications is needing various resources and support, which may be causing additional expenses for a company. The use of Cloud computing in web development meets this requirement optimally by offering their already available resources.
Cloud computing is a cost-effective solution concerning maintenance and data storage. Generally, application data are maintained in on-premises or remote data centers, which is becoming a significant investment. On the other hand, there is no headache for cloud-based applications for managing an on-premises data center or planning for disaster recovery.
The Flexibility of Access as Per Need:
The benefits of cloud computing in web development are offering more flexibility in terms of sharing and restricting access to data on a real-time basis. A company may offer access to its web developers only for development-related data and restrict user data access.
With the cloud-based facility, both the organization and the web developer or web designer get the flexibility to work on the fly. therefore, they don’t require a dedicated system to continue to work. And they are able to collaborate from anywhere if they have internet connectivity.
Hence, with the help of web app development platforms through cloud computing, it has become a necessity for professional web designers and developers. This is nothing but software hosted on a cloud and can be accessed from anywhere with the help of the internet.
Contact us for elevating your business!
What is the cloud in web application development?
A cloud application is a software that helps to run its processing logic and data storage between 2 different systems. That is, client-side and server-side. Some processing takes place on an end user’s local hardware, such as a mobile device or desktop, and some takes place on a remote server.
What are the 6 main characteristics of cloud computing?
6 major characteristics of cloud computing
- On-demand self-service
- Resource pooling
- Scalability and rapid elasticity
- Pay-per-use pricing
- Measured service
- Resiliency and availability